David McIntosh: The World Needs More Blood Collectors, Not Just More Donors

David McIntosh, Founder and Chair of United Plasma Action, shared Hong Kong Red Cross Blood Transfusion Service’s post on LinkedIn:

”Global blood services (well, actually a small group of rich country services) are calling for more blood donors (as below) …..

Meanwhile, globally, patients, carers and clinicians are calling for more blood collectors!

It’s typical, and quite seriously shameful, of High Income Country Blood Transfusion Services to assume that the rest of the World has the same blood problems that they do.

Well funded, well staffed and well equipped as they are, they only have to issue a quick Press Release and all the donors they need will come out in enthusiastic multitudes.

In other less fortunate parts of the World – over 80% of the whole – the issues are MUCH more serious. Unnecessary suffering and avoidable mortality are rife.

Calling for more donors is a peripheral ploy that offers very little added value.

Such calls are frustrating for potential donors in most Low and Middle Income Countries – where, however many citizens come forward, the simple sad fact is that utterly inadequate facilities exist to provide opportunities to donate and to deal appropriately with more donors’ gifts.

What the majority of countries need is MUCH more investment in collection.

Do please let’s be realistic about that.

Patients, carers and clinicians, globally, deserve nothing less.”

Hong Kong Red Cross Blood Transfusion Service shared a post on LinkedIn:

”Low blood supply isn’t just a Hong Kong issue.

It’s a global challenge.

Canadian Blood Services, Australian Red Cross Lifeblood and NHS Blood and Transplant have joined forces in to call for more blood donors. We want to echo the campaign and broaden the influences across border. As some countries’ inventories are facing a 30 percent fall over the pass few months. Here in Hong Kong, our inventories have dropped by around 20 percent since June. We need your help to replenish our inventories!

Extreme weather from the recent typhoon season inevitably impacted our blood collection. The heavy rainstorms and severe tropical storm in late July widening the gap between supply and medical demand of blood.
